Setting up email authentication: spf, dkim, and dmarc configuration

Step-by-Step Implementation of SPF and DKIM Records

Proper domain authentication forms the bedrock of successful email delivery, protecting your brand reputation whilst signalling to receiving servers that your messages deserve trust. Sender Policy Framework records specify which mail servers are authorised to send emails on behalf of your domain, effectively creating a whitelist that receiving systems can consult when evaluating incoming messages. To implement SPF, you must access your domain's DNS settings and create a TXT record that lists the IP addresses or domains permitted to send email for your organisation. Critsend provides specific values that should appear in this record, ensuring that messages sent through their relay service pass SPF checks. DomainKeys Identified Mail adds another layer of authentication by attaching a digital signature to outgoing messages, allowing receiving servers to verify that the content has not been altered during transmission and genuinely originates from your domain. Setting up DKIM requires generating a cryptographic key pair, adding the public key to your DNS records as another TXT entry, and configuring Critsend to sign outgoing messages with the corresponding private key. These authentication protocols work in tandem to establish credibility, with inbox providers increasingly requiring their presence before accepting bulk email traffic.

Configuring dmarc to strengthen email security

Domain-based Message Authentication Reporting and Conformance represents the final component of a comprehensive email authentication strategy, building upon SPF and DKIM to provide clear instructions to receiving servers about how to handle messages that fail verification checks. DMARC policies allow you to specify whether suspicious messages should be quarantined, rejected outright, or delivered with warnings, giving you control over how your domain is used in email communications. Implementation begins with creating another DNS TXT record at a specific subdomain, typically formatted to indicate your chosen policy alongside reporting email addresses where you wish to receive feedback about authentication results. Starting with a monitoring-only policy proves prudent, allowing you to observe how your legitimate email traffic performs against authentication checks before implementing stricter enforcement that might inadvertently block valid messages. As confidence grows and any authentication issues are resolved, you can progressively strengthen the policy to instruct receiving servers to reject emails that fail verification, significantly reducing the likelihood that fraudsters can successfully impersonate your organisation. Regular review of DMARC reports provides valuable insights into potential security threats, misconfigured systems, or unauthorised sending sources attempting to use your domain, enabling proactive responses that protect both your organisation and your email recipients from malicious activity.

Monitoring open rates and click-through performance metrics

Comprehensive analytics transform email marketing from guesswork into a data-driven discipline, providing visibility into how recipients interact with your messages and where opportunities for improvement exist. Critsend delivers detailed tracking that captures essential metrics including open rates, click-through rates, bounce rates, and unsubscribe frequencies, allowing marketers to assess campaign performance at both aggregate and individual message levels. Open rate monitoring reveals which subject lines and preview text combinations successfully capture attention, whilst click-through analysis identifies which calls to action, content sections, or offers generate the strongest response. Bounce rate management helps maintain list hygiene by flagging addresses that consistently fail to receive messages, whether due to temporary delivery issues or permanent problems such as non-existent accounts. The platform distinguishes between hard bounces that require immediate list removal and soft bounces that might resolve with subsequent attempts, protecting sender reputation by preventing continued attempts to reach unreachable addresses. Geographic and temporal data reveal when and where your audience engages most actively, informing decisions about optimal sending times and regional targeting strategies. Comparing performance across different segments, message variations, or campaign types builds institutional knowledge about what resonates with your audience, enabling continuous refinement of approach and increasingly effective communications over time.
